According to Samuel, Saul's stubbornness against God is comparable to
- A. murder
- B. divination
- C. idolatry
- D. lying
Correct Answer: C. idolatry
Explanation
This is found in 1 Samuel 15:23. Samuel rebukes Saul for not fully obeying God's command to utterly destroy the Amalekites and their possessions. Samuel equates Saul's disobedience and stubbornness to rebellion, likening it to the sin of idolatry: For rebellion is as the sin of divination, and stubbornness is as iniquity and idolatry. Because you have rejected the word of the Lord, he has also rejected you from being king.
